Jose Mourinho is planning to make big changes to Real Madrid as he gears up for his appointment as the new head coach.

One of the big changes will be to bring in a star player to feature alongside the likes of Kylian Mbappe and Vinicius Jr. Mourinho appears to have already found the answer in the form of Michael Olise.

Although Real Madrid have not been actively linked with a move for Olise this summer, the rumours have intensified after Mourinho was spotted in Berlin, watching the DFB Pokal final between Bayern Munich and VfB Stuttgart.

Uli Hoeness reacts to Mourinho’s visit

Heading into the cup final, Bayern Munich’s honorary president, Uli Hoeness, was asked about Mourinho’s visit to watch Olise, to which he didn’t hold back.

“José Mourinho is in the stadium tonight to keep an eye on Michael Olise for Real Madrid? He can keep 5 eyes on him, he still won’t get him,” he said (h/t Fabrizio Romano).

Hoeness’ comments do appear to be out of spite, especially considering Bayern Munich’s history of losing players to Real Madrid.

More than a decade ago, Bayern Munich lost Toni Kroos to Real Madrid, and the rest is history. David Alaba, too, left the Bavarian club to join Los Blancos in recent memory.

Is Olise a viable target for Real Madrid?

Jose Mourinho going after Olise could prove to be a masterstroke as the Bayern Munich star has been one of the standout players in Europe this season, racking up 22 goals and 30 assists in 51 competitive matches.

Olise could be the missing piece that binds together Mbappe and Vinicius in the Real Madrid frontline. He is also one of the best dribblers in world football and can be Real Madrid’s answer to Barcelona’s Lamine Yamal.

However, signing Olise will be difficult, with Bayern Munich not interested in selling their star man at all. So unless Real Madrid can engineer a massive coup, it is unlikely the Frenchman is leaving Bavaria anytime soon.
